A family went camping 48 Km from town. They drove 24 km more than they walked.
How many of each did they walk?

We can represent variable w for the kilometers walked.
"24 kilometers more than they walked" would mean 24+w.
Thus, the equation we create would be:
24+w+w=48.
Combine like terms.
24+2w=48.
Subtract 24 from both sides.
2w=24.
Divide by 2 on both sides in order to isolate w.
w=12.

They each walked 12 kilometers.
